Output 6606bec26dd2a3f6b84d5b9bd21a5e8a950b9905ecb2d2c4f8cfcc18ad1d2531:0

value
10550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a7f27e8dcef29f8b3e5b1edfc81ff621ca260e OP_EQUAL
address
3DsizEf2A5zm4rwKjzQ82kEYvZ7jE3scKP
transaction
6606bec26dd2a3f6b84d5b9bd21a5e8a950b9905ecb2d2c4f8cfcc18ad1d2531